Устраняем ошибку «Сбой запроса дескриптора USB-устройства» в Windows 10
Ошибка дескриптора USB
Данная ошибка говорит нам о том, что устройство, подключенное к одному из портов USB, вернуло какую-то ошибку и было отключено системой. При этом в «Диспетчере устройств» оно отображается как «Неизвестное» с соответствующей припиской.
Причин, вызывающих подобный сбой множество – от недостатка питания до неисправности порта или самого девайса. Далее мы разберем все возможные варианты развития событий и приведем способы решения проблемы.
Причина 1: Неисправность устройства или порта
Прежде чем переходить к выявлению причин неполадки, необходимо убедиться в исправности разъема и того девайса, что в него подключен. Делается это просто: нужно попробовать подключить устройство к другому порту. Если оно заработало, а в «Диспетчере» больше нет ошибок, то неисправно гнездо USB. Также необходимо взять заведомо исправную флешку и включить ее в тот же разъем. Если все в порядке, значит, не работает само устройство.
Проблема с портами решается только путем обращения в сервисный центр. Флешку же можно попытаться восстановить или отправить на свалку. Инструкции по восстановлению можно найти на нашем сайте, перейдя на главную страницу и введя в поисковую строку запрос «восстановить флешку».
Причина 2: Недостаток питания
Как известно, для работы любых устройств требуется электроэнергия. Для каждого порта USB выделяется определенный лимит потребления, превышение которого приводит к различным сбоям, в том числе и к обсуждаемому в этой статье. Чаще всего такое происходит при использовании хабов (разветвителей) без дополнительного питания. Проверить лимиты и расход можно в соответствующей системной оснастке.
- Жмем ПКМ по кнопки «Пуск» и переходим к «Диспетчеру устройств».
Раскрываем ветку с контроллерами USB. Теперь нам нужно пройтись по всем устройствам по очереди и проверить, не превышен ли лимит питания. Просто кликаем дважды по названию, переходим на вкладку «Питание» (если таковая имеется) и смотрим на цифры.
Если сумма значений в столбце «Требует питания» больше, чем «Доступная мощность», необходимо отключить лишние устройства или подключить их к другим портам. Также можно попробовать использовать разветвитель с дополнительным питанием.
Причина 3: Энергосберегающие технологии
Данная проблема в основном наблюдается на ноутбуках, но может присутствовать и на стационарных ПК из-за системных ошибок. Дело в том, что «энергосберегайки» работают таким образом, что при недостатке питания (села батарея) некоторые устройства подлежат отключению. Исправить это можно в том же «Диспетчере устройств», а также, посетив раздел настроек электропитания.
- Идем в «Диспетчер» (см. выше), открываем уже знакомую нам ветку с USB и снова проходимся по всему списку, проверяя один параметр. Находится он на вкладке «Управление электропитанием». Возле указанной на скриншоте позиции снимаем флажок и жмем ОК.
Вызываем контекстное меню кликом ПКМ по кнопке «Пуск» и переходим к «Управлению электропитанием».
Идем в «Дополнительные параметры питания».
Кликаем по ссылке настроек возле активной схемы, напротив которой стоит переключатель.
Далее жмем «Изменить дополнительные параметры питания».
Полностью раскрываем ветку с параметрами USB и выставляем значение «Запрещено». Нажимаем «Применить».
Причина 4: Статический заряд
При продолжительной работе компьютера на его компонентах скапливается статическое электричество, что может приводить к множеству проблем, вплоть до выхода комплектующих из строя. Сбросить статику можно следующим образом:
- Выключаем машину.
- Отключаем блок питания клавишей на задней стенке. Из ноута вынимаем батарею.
- Вынимаем вилку из розетки.
- Зажимаем кнопку питания (включения) не менее чем на десять секунд.
- Включаем все обратно и проверяем работоспособность портов.
Минимизировать шансы появления статического электричества поможет заземление компьютера.
Причина 5: Сбой в настройках BIOS
BIOS – микропрограммное обеспечение – помогает системе обнаруживать устройства. Если в нем произошел сбой, возможно возникновение различных ошибок. Решением здесь может стать сброс настроек к значениям по умолчанию.
Причина 6: Драйвера
Драйвера позволяют ОС «общаться» с устройствами и управлять их поведением. Если такая программа повреждена или отсутствует, девайс не будет нормально функционировать. Решить проблему можно, попытавшись вручную обновить драйвер для нашего «Неизвестного устройства» или выполнив комплексный апдейт с помощью специальной программы.
Заключение
Как видите, причин, вызывающих сбой дескриптора USB довольно много, и в основном они имеют под собой электрическую основу. Системные параметры также в значительной мере влияют на нормальную работу портов. Если же самостоятельно решить задачу по устранению причин не удалось, следует обратиться к специалистам, лучше с личным визитом в мастерскую.
Сбой запроса дескриптора устройства (код 43) в Windows 10 и 8
Если при подключении чего-либо по USB в Windows 10 или Windows 8 (8.1) — флешки, телефона, планшета, плеера или чего-либо еще (а иногда и просто кабеля USB) вы видите в диспетчере устройств Неизвестное USB-устройство и сообщение об «Сбой запроса дескриптора устройства» с указанием ошибки Код 43 (в свойствах), в этой инструкции постараюсь дать работающие способы исправить эту ошибку. Еще один вариант этой же ошибки — сбой сброса порта.
По спецификации сбой запроса дескриптора устройства или сброса порта и код ошибки 43 говорят о том, что не все в порядке с подключением (физическим) к USB устройству, однако по факту, не всегда причина оказывается именно в этом (но, если что-то делалось с портами на устройствах или есть вероятность их загрязнения или окисления, проверьте и этот фактор, аналогично — если вы подключаете что-то через USB-хаб, попробуйте подключить напрямую к порту USB). Чаще — дело в установленных драйверах Windows или их неправильной работе, но рассмотрим все и другие варианты. Также может оказаться полезной статья: USB устройство не опознано в Windows
Обновление драйверов Составного USB устройства и Корневых USB-концентраторов
Если до настоящего момента подобных проблем замечено не было, а ваше устройство начало определяться как «Неизвестное USB-устройство» ни с того ни с сего, рекомендую начать с этого способа решения проблемы, как с самого простого и, обычно, самого работоспособного.
- Зайдите в диспетчер устройств Windows. Сделать это можно, нажав клавиши Windows + R и введя devmgmt.msc (или через правый клик по кнопке «Пуск»).
- Откройте раздел «Контроллеры USB».
- Для каждого из устройств Generic USB Hub, Корневой USB-концентратор и Составное USB устройство выполните следующие действия.
- Кликните по устройству правой кнопкой мыши, выберите пункт «Обновить драйверы».
- Выберите пункт «Выполнить поиск драйверов на этом компьютере».
- Выберите «Выбрать из списка уже установленных драйверов».
- В списке (там, вероятнее всего будет лишь один совместимый драйвер) выберите его и нажмите «Далее».
И так для каждого из указанных устройств. Что должно произойти (в случае успеха): при обновлении (а точнее — переустановке) одного из этих драйверов ваше «Неизвестное устройство» исчезнет и снова появится, уже как опознанное. После этого, с остальными драйверами продолжать это необязательно.
Дополнительно: если сообщение о том, что USB устройство не опознано появляется у вас в Windows 10 и только при подключении к USB 3.0 (проблема типична для ноутбуков, обновленных до новой ОС), то здесь обычно помогает замена стандартного, устанавливаемого самой ОС драйвера Расширяемый хост-контроллер Intel USB 3.0 на тот драйвер, который имеется на официальном сайте производителя ноутбука или материнской платы. Также для этого устройства в диспетчере устройств можно попробовать и метод, описанный ранее (обновление драйверов).
Параметры энергосбережения USB
Если предыдущий способ сработал, а через некоторое время ваша Windows 10 или 8-ка снова начала писать о сбое дескриптора устройства и код 43, тут может помочь дополнительное действие — отключение функций энергосбережения для USB-портов.
Для этого, также, как и в предыдущем способе, зайдите в диспетчер устройств и для всех устройств Generic USB Hub, Корневой USB концентратор и Составное USB устройство откройте через правый клик «Свойства», а затем на вкладке «Управление электропитанием» отключите параметр «Разрешить отключение этого устройства для экономии энергии». Примените сделанные настройки.
Неправильная работа USB устройств из-за проблем с питанием или статического электричества
Достаточно часто проблемы с работой подключаемых USB устройств и сбоем дескриптора устройства можно решить простым обесточиванием компьютера или ноутбука. Как это сделать для ПК:
- Извлеките проблемные USB-устройства, выключите компьютер (через завершение работы, лучше, при нажатии «Завершение работы» удерживать Shift, для полного его выключения).
- Выключите его из розетки.
- Нажмите и держите кнопку питания нажатой секунд 5-10 (да, на выключенном из розетки компьютере), отпустите.
- Включите компьютер в сеть и просто включите его как обычно.
- Подключите USB устройство снова.
Для ноутбуков у которых снимается батарея все действия будут теми же, разве что в пункте 2 добавится «снимите аккумулятор с ноутбука». Этот же способ может помочь, когда Компьютер не видит флешку (в указанной инструкции есть дополнительные методы исправить это).
Драйвера на чипсет
И еще один пункт, который может вызывать сбой запроса дескриптора USB-устройства или сбой сброса порта — не установленные официальные драйвера на чипсет (которые следует брать с официального сайта производителя ноутбука для вашей модели или с сайта производителя материнской платы компьютера). Те, что устанавливает сама Windows 10 или 8, а также драйвера из драйвер-пака не всегда оказываются полностью рабочими (хотя в диспетчере устройств вы, вероятнее всего, увидите, что все устройства работают нормально, за исключением неопознанного USB).
К таким драйверам могут относиться
- Intel Chipset Driver
- Intel Management Engine Interface
- Различные Firmware утилиты специфичные для ноутбуков
- ACPI Driver
- Иногда, отдельные драйвера USB для сторонних контроллеров на материнской плате.
Не поленитесь зайти на сайт производителя в раздел поддержки и проверить наличие таких драйверов. Если они отсутствуют для вашей версии Windows, можно попробовать установку предыдущих версий в режиме совместимости (главное, чтобы совпадала разрядность).
На данный момент это всё, что я могу предложить. Нашли собственные решения или сработало что-то из описанного? — буду рад, если поделитесь в комментариях.
Сбой запроса дескриптора usb-устройства (код 43) без видимой причины.
Внезапно, после месяца абсолютно нормальной эксплуатации(ноутбук на Вин10) вчера отвалился один из usb-портов — просто перестал работать. Устройства типа флешек не видит вообще, при подключении устройств, которым нужно питание от юсб(например, внешней звуковой карты или клавиатуры) пишет что что-то подключено, однако, устройства не работают, питание им не поступает, в диспетчере устройств выдает как раз «сбой запроса дескриптора, код 43».
Во избежание банальных ответов вроде «обновите драйвер через диспетчер устройств» или «проверьте параметры электропитания»:
1) Ничего не обновлялось/устанавливалось, просто днем порт работал, а вечером уже нет.
2) Драйвера чипсета(которые и так стояли последние) с сайта производителя пробовал обновить, ничего не происходит. Либо пишет, что все драйвера на месте, либо преустанавливает с нулевым эффектом.
3) При попытке обновить драйвер через диспетчер устройств(как с жесткого диска компьютера, так и автоматический поиск в сети) пишет, что устройство в обновлении драйверов не нуждается.
4) В параметрах электропитания и свойствах юсб-концетраторов полностью запрещено отключение питания портов.
Вопрос знатокам: куда копать? Очевидные способы перепробованы, надеюсь на ваши более глубокие познания. Беглый поиск в гугле решений не дал. В похожих вопросах на сайте решения своей проблемы тоже не отыскал. С моей стороны перед поломкой никаких телодвижений по обновлению/установке чего либо не предпринималось — порт просто перестал работать без всякой видимой для меня причины. Разве что какие-то тихие обновления системы.
П.С. Сейчас буду пробовать полностью снести все драйвера всех usb-устройств и установить их начисто с сайта производителя.
UPD. Удаление драйверов юсб-концертраторов и хостов не помогло, их переустановка не дала ничего. После удаления «проблемного» устройства оно вообще перестает отображаться в «диспетчере устройств», отображается лишь при подключении в этот порт другого девайса.